Is Interface (TILE) Undervalued As Its Share Price Pullback Tests Fair Value?

Interface (TILE) has drawn attention after its recent share performance, with the stock down 12.2% over the past month but still up 6.2% over the past 3 months. Investors are reassessing the flooring specialist’s valuation.

The share price has cooled in recent weeks, with a 1-day decline of 1.91% and a 7-day drop of 6.98%. However, Interface still shows positive momentum when you zoom out, with a year-to-date share price return of 19.11% and a 3-year total shareholder return of 244.87%. This indicates that recent weakness follows a much stronger multi-year run.

Most Popular Narrative: 25.2% Undervalued

Interface is priced at $33.85 against a widely followed fair value estimate of $45.25, which frames the recent pullback as a valuation gap rather than just a sentiment swing.

Operational enhancements such as automation and robotics, now fully deployed in the U.S. and soon rolling out to Australia and Europe, are yielding significant manufacturing productivity improvements and are expected to further enhance gross margins and earnings as international deployment progresses.

Still, Interface faces real swing factors, including heavy reliance on the U.S. commercial cycle and rising low cost flooring competitors that could squeeze its pricing power.
